20春重庆大学《Java程序设计》第2次

[复制链接]
查看: 1279|回复: 0

5万

主题

8万

帖子

18万

积分

论坛元老

Rank: 8Rank: 8

积分
189003
发表于 2020-11-6 13:21:01 | 显示全部楼层 |阅读模式
1.[单选]package语句的作用是( )
    A.引入一个包
    B.创建一个包
    C.既能引入一个包,又能创建一个包
    D.以上皆不对
    正确答案加微信:(1144766066)案:——B——
2.[单选题]在某类的子类中,下述方法中必须要实现的方法是( )。
    A.Public double methoda();
    B.Static void methoda (double d1);
    C.Public native double methoda();
    D.Abstract public void methoda();
    正确答案加微信:(1144766066)案:————
3.[单选题]关于下列程序结果正确的是( )  public class MyClass{ static int i;  public static void main(String argv[]){  System.out.println(i);  } }
    A.Error Variable i may not have been initialized
    B.Null
    C.1
    D.0
    正确答案加微信:(1144766066)案:——D——
4.[单选题]下列选项中为java关键字的是( )
    A.default
    B.Run
    C.Integer
    D.implement
    正确答案加微信:(1144766066)案:————
5.[单选题]下列哪个方法可以获得一个事件的ID号( )
    A.int getID()
    B.String getSource()
    C.int returnID()
    D.int eventID()
    正确答案加微信:(1144766066)案:————
6.[单选题]若所用变量都已正确定义,以下选项中,非法的表达式是( )。
    A.a!=4||b==1;
    B.'a' % 3;
    C.'a'=1/2;
    D.'A' + 32;
    正确答案加微信:(1144766066)案:————
7.[单选题]给定File f=new File("aa.txt");可以实现向文件尾部读写的是( )。
    A.RandomAccessFile f1=new RandomAccessFile(f,"r");
    B.RandomAccessFile f1=new RandomAccessFile(f,"a");
    C.RandomAccessFile f1=new RandomAccessFile(f,"rw");
    D.RandomAccessFile f1=new RandomAccessFile(f,"w");
    正确答案加微信:(1144766066)案:————
8.[单选题]容器被重新设置大小后,哪种布局管理器的容器中的组件大小不随容器大小的变化而改变? ( )
    A.CardLayout
    B.FlowLayout
    C.BorderLayout
    D.GridLayout
    正确答案加微信:(1144766066)案:————
9.[单选题]关于线程的下列说法正确的是( )
    A.线程只能通过继承类Thread创建.
    B.执行suspend方法将使线程停止并不能被重新start.
    C.线程与进程实际是同一个概念.
    D.线程的终止可以通过两种方式实现:自然撤销或被停止.
    正确答案加微信:(1144766066)案:————
10.[单选题]下列哪个不是整数类型的变量( )
    A.-10
    B.045
    C.0xa1
    D.67f
    正确答案加微信:(1144766066)案:————
11.[单选题]下列哪个选项不会出现编译错误?( )
    A.float f = 1.3;
    B.char c = "a";
    C.byte b = 257;
    D.int i = 10;
    正确答案加微信:(1144766066)案:————
12.[单选题]main方法是Java Application程序执行的入口点,关于main方法的方法头以下哪项是合法的?( )
    A.public static void main()
    B.public static void main(String[ ] args)
    C.public static int main(String[ ] arg)
    D.public void main(String arg[ ])
    正确答案加微信:(1144766066)案:————
13.[单选题]以下程序 boolean a=false;  boolean b=true;  boolean c=(a&&b)&&(!b);  int result=c==false?1:2;  执行完后,c与result的值是( )
    A.c=false;result=1;
    B.c=true;result=2;
    C.c=true;result=1;
    D.c=false;result=2;
    正确答案加微信:(1144766066)案:————
14.[单选题]给定以下程序段  insert code public class foo { public static void main (String[] args) throws Exception {  printWriter out = new PrintWriter (new java.io.outputStreamWriter (System.out), true) ;  out.printIn(“Hello”);  } }  要使程序能正确运行,在insert code处必须添加( )语句
    A.import java.io.PrintWriter;
    B.include java.io.PrintWriter;
    C.import java.io.OutputStreamWriter;
    D.include java.io.OutputStreamWriter;
    正确答案加微信:(1144766066)案:————
15.[单选题]如果要向文件file.txt中添加数据,应如何构建输出流( )
    A.OutputStream out=new FileOutputStream(“file.txt”);
    B.OutputStream out=new FileOutputStream(“file.txt”, “append”);
    C.FileOutputStream out=new FileOutputStream(“file.txt”, true);
    D.FileOutputStream out=new FileOutputStream(new file(“file.txt”));
    正确答案加微信:(1144766066)案:————
16.[单选题]设 x,y 均为已定义的类名,下列声明对象x1的语句中正确的是( )
    A.public x x1= new y( );
    B.x x1=x( );
    C.x x1=new x( );
    D.int x x1;
    正确答案加微信:(1144766066)案:————
17.[单选题]假定有一个可能引起异常的方法,用什么方式告诉方法的调用者要捕获该异常?( )
    A.throw Exception
    B.throws Exception
    C.new Exception
    D.不用特别指定
    正确答案加微信:(1144766066)案:————
18.[单选题]假定组件List定义为List l=new List(5,true),则下列描述正确的是( )
    A.该列表的最大容量为5
    B.该列表可显示5行,并且为多选模式
    C.该列表可显示5行,并且为单选模式
    D.以上均不对
    正确答案加微信:(1144766066)案:————
19.[单选题]下列说法错误的是( )。
    A.Java Application命名必须与公共类名相同
    B.自定义Applet通常是类Applet的子类
    C.Applet中也可以有main()方法
    D.一个Java Application文件中可以定义多个类
    正确答案加微信:(1144766066)案:————
20.[单选题]下式中给字符串数组正确赋值的语句是( )。
    A.String temp [] = new String {"j", "a", "z"};
    B.String temp [] = { "j " " b" "c"};
    C.String temp = {"a", "b", "c"};
    D.String temp [] = {"a", "b", "c"};
    正确答案加微信:(1144766066)案:————
21.[单选题]给出下列代码段:  if(x>4){ System.out.println(“Test 1”);  } else if(x>9){  System.out.println(“Test 2”); } else { System.out.println(“Test 3”); }  哪一个范围的x取值可以产生输出信息:”Test 3” ( )
    A.小于0
    B.5到9之间
    C.大于等于10
    D.以上均不对
    正确答案加微信:(1144766066)案:————
22.[单选题]下列哪个选项不能使当前线程停止执行?( )
    A.一个异常被抛出
    B.线程执行了sleep()调用
    C.高优先级的线程处于可运行状态
    D.当前线程产生了一个新线程
    正确答案加微信:(1144766066)案:————
23.[单选题]StringBuffer str=new StringBuffer(25);String s=”Hello”,若执行语句str.append(s)后,str.length()和str.capacity()的返回值为( )
    A.5,5
    B.25,5
    C.5,25
    D.25,25
    正确答案加微信:(1144766066)案:————
24.[单选题]关于下列程序  public class Q {  public static void main(String argv[]){  int anar[]= new int[]{1,2,3}; System.out.println(anar[1]);  } }  以下结论正确的是( )
    A.发生编译错误
    B.1
    C.2
    D.数组长度未指定
    正确答案加微信:(1144766066)案:————
25.[单选题]如果定义一个线程类,它继承自Thread,则我们必须重写其中的( )方法
    A.run
    B.start
    C.yield
    D.stop
    正确答案加微信:(1144766066)案:————
26.[单选题]下列哪个说法是正确的( )
    A.Java 语言只允许单一继承
    B.Java 语言只允许实现一个接口
    C.Java 语言不允许同时继承一个类并实现一个接口
    D.以上说法均不对
    正确答案加微信:(1144766066)案:————
27.[单选题]给定语句:<BR> <BR>则语句s.substring(iBegin,iEnd)的结果为( )
    A.Bic
    B.ic
    C.icy
    D.运行错误
    正确答案加微信:(1144766066)案:————
28.[单选题]下列不属于构成元素的是().
    A.消息的接收者
    B.消息的发送者
    C.消息所需参数
    D.消息所对应的方法名
    正确答案加微信:(1144766066)案:————
29.[单选题]一个文件名为first的Java源文件,编译后得到的类文件为()
    A.first.java
    B.first.class
    C.first.c
    D.上述均不对
    正确答案加微信:(1144766066)案:————
30.[单选题]关键字( )用来声明该变量为不可更新.
    A.extends
    B.final
    C.import
    D.void
    正确答案加微信:(1144766066)案:————
31.[判断题]Java语言支持类的序列化.( )
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
32.[判断题]Default子句只能出现在case子句后.( )
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
33.[判断题]Java的编译环境和运行环境必须在同一台机器上.()
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
34.[判断题]进行AWT绘制时,需要程序员重写repaint()方法。( )
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
35.[判断题]组件必须放置在一定的容器中才能显示.( )
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
36.[判断题]一个Java应用中可以含有多个类,其中有而且只有一个类中含有main()方法.( )
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
37.[判断题]在一个确定的语句块中变量不能同名.( )
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
38.[判断题]抽象类的抽象方法必须在该类的子类中具体实现.( )
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
39.[判断题]在执行更新数据库操作时,不能设置输入参数.()
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————
40.[判断题]Java程序是由若干类定义组成的,类定义包括定义类头和定义类体.()
    A.正确
    B.错误
    正确答案加微信:(1144766066)案:————

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x





上一篇:重庆大学20春
下一篇:《工程招投标》第2次
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

精彩课程推荐
|网站地图|网站地图